The 3 months correlation between Right and Grand is 0.52.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Right On Brands and Grand Havana in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Grand Havana and Right On is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Right On Brands are associated (or correlated) with Grand Havana.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Grand Havana has no effect on the direction of Right On i.e., Right On and Grand Havana go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Right On and Grand Havana
The main advantage of trading using opposite Right On and Grand Havana posit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Right On position performs unexpectedly, Grand Havana can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
